We are seeking a dynamic Dental Nurse Tutor Assistant to join our team at Bristol Dental School. We are a city centre state-of-the-art site located at 1 Trinity Quay, Avon Street, Bristol, delivering a new operating model for dental education since opening Summer of 2023. The role is full-time, Monday-Friday, 35 hours per week.
Main duties of the job- Assisting with the delivery of teaching and assessment materials.
- Contribute to the design and development of lectures and assessments.
- Help maintain high standards of teaching and learning outcomes.
- Support trainee dental nurses in their clinical training alongside the Clinical Dental Nurse Tutor.
- Escalate issues to the Programme Director as required.
- Participate in recruitment and enrolment activities, including attending fairs and engaging with schools and community groups.
- Support interview processes for prospective students.
- Provide a visible clinical presence to guide students and assist with peer reviews and progression.
- Promote equality, diversity, and inclusion while offering pastoral support.
- Provide specific areas of administration related to the programme
- Attend meetings to discuss student matters and represent the team at School Exam Boards when required.

Person Specification Qualifications- National Certificate for Dental Nurses and registered with the GDC
- A recognised teaching Certificate Level 3 or above (for example City and Guilds Preparing to Teach in the Lifelong Learning Sector or working towards obtaining this qualification
- A recognised Assessor qualification (For example TQUK Level 3 certificate in assessing vocational achievement RQF, CAVA)
- Post Qualifications or working towards
- Detailed specialist knowledge and refined skills; demonstrated experience in Dental Nursing
- Knowledge and understanding of the GDC intended learning outcomes associated with dental nurse training and safe practitioner and how these learning outcomes are assessed
- Experience of supervising, coaching or mentoring trainee or junior dental nurses or clinical assistants
- Evidence of Continuing Professional Development and keeping up to date to reflect any changes instituted by the General Dental Council
- Worked as part of a dental team and participated in teaching/training sessions for dental nurses and students across all dental specialities
